I know that in Sonar you can add any and all of the MIDI controller data via a midi controller over already recorded midi notes using the sound on sound command. I thought you could do the same thing in RealBand. I just tried it out and now I know you can. Click on the track that has your midi notes, click on the midi record button and move your keyboard controller knobs, sliders and buttons while the song is playing. RB will record your movements without erasing your notes, hence it is the same thing as Sonar’s sound on sound recording. You will end up with both the midi notes and CC/wheel data on the same track. You can use the piano roll view to edit any data on that track.
